MORIN spake thusly: > Currently, defining a config fragment in the runtime test infra requires > that the fragment not to be indented. This is beark, and causes grievance > when looking at the code (e.g. to fix it). > > Just strip out all leading spaces/tabs when writing the configuration > lines into the config file, allowing in-line indented config fragments, > like so: > > class TestFoo(bla): > config = bla.config + \ > """ > FOO=y > # BAR is not set > """ > > Signed-off-by: "Yann E. MORIN" > Cc: Thomas Petazzoni > > --- > Changes v1 -> v2: > - add example in commit log (Thomas) > > --- > Note: this is only tangentially related to this series, because it is > needed by the last patch in the series. It wasalready submitted before: > https://patchwork.ozlabs.org/patch/788985/ > --- > support/testing/infra/builder.py | 3 ++- > 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-) > > diff --git a/support/testing/infra/builder.py b/support/testing/infra/builder.py > index a475bb0a30..81735dec96 100644 > --- a/support/testing/infra/builder.py > +++ b/support/testing/infra/builder.py > @@ -16,7 +16,8 @@ class Builder(object): > > config_file = os.path.join(self.builddir, ".config") > with open(config_file, "w+") as cf: > - cf.write(self.config) > + for line in self.config.splitlines(): > + cf.write("{}\n".format(line.lstrip())) > > cmd = ["make", > "O={}".format(self.builddir), > -- > 2.11.0 > -- .-----------------.--------------------.------------------.--------------------. | Yann E.
